8,694,609 (eight million six hundred ninety-four thousand six hundred nine) is an odd 7-digit number. It is a composite number with 48 divisors, and factors as 3 × 7² × 11 × 19 × 283. Written other ways, in hexadecimal, 0x84AB51.
